Description

3,3'-(1H-Isoindole-1,3(2H)-Diylidene)Bisquinoline-2,4(1H,3H)-Dione is a specialized heterocyclic organic compound with a complex fused-ring structure. This chemical is valued for its unique chromophoric and electronic properties, making it a critical intermediate in advanced material synthesis. It is primarily sought by research institutions and industrial manufacturers in the pharmaceutical, agrochemical, and organic electronics sectors for developing novel active ingredients and functional materials.

Basic Information

Product Name 3,3'-(1H-Isoindole-1,3(2H)-Diylidene)Bisquinoline-2,4(1H,3H)-Dione
CAS No. 85223-06-9
Molecular Formula C26H14N2O4
Molecular Weight 418.40 g/mol
Synonyms 1H-Isoindole-1,3(2H)-diylidenebis(2,4(1H,3H)-quinolinedione); 3,3'-(1H-Isoindole-1,3(2H)-diylidene)bis(1,2-dihydro-2,4-quinolinedione); Bisquinoline Isoindole Dione; 85223-06-9; Quinophthalone derivative; Isoindole-1,3-diylidenebisquinolinedione
